计算机图形学基础知识及应用技术
需积分: 14 188 浏览量
更新于2024-08-23
收藏 14.49MB PPT 举报
计算机图形学综述
计算机图形学是研究用计算机表示、生成、处理和显示图形的学科。它涉及将几何模型和数字转变为图形的各种算法和技术。计算机图形学的发展简史可以追溯到1950年代,第一台图形显示器作为美国麻省理工学院(MIT)旋风I号(WhirlwindI)计算机的附件诞生。
计算机图形学的主要内容包括:
1. 图形系统的框架及其涉及的软件、硬件技术
2. 图形学基本问题,掌握基本概念、方法与算法
3. 基本图形(二维)和几何实体(三维)生成技术
4. 具有一定实践体会和相关的编程能力
计算机图形学的应用非常广泛,包括计算机辅助设计(CAD)、计算机生成图像(CGI)、虚拟现实(VR)、增强现实(AR)、人机交互(HCI)等领域。
计算机图形学的发展离不开硬件的发展,硬件的发展推动了计算机图形学的发展。1950年代,第一台图形显示器作为美国麻省理工学院(MIT)旋风I号(WhirlwindI)计算机的附件诞生。从那以后,计算机图形学的发展速度加快,新的技术和算法不断涌现。
计算机图形学的教学基本要求包括:
1. 了解图形系统的框架及其涉及的软件、硬件技术
2. 了解图形学基本问题,掌握基本概念、方法与算法
3. 掌握基本图形(二维)和几何实体(三维)生成技术
4. 具有一定实践体会和相关的编程能力
计算机图形学的教学资源包括:
1. Donald Hearn, M. Pauline Baker, “Computer Graphics (C Version)”, Prentice Hall, 1997.
2. 计算机图形学(新版)孙家广编清华大学出版社
3. 计算机图形学基础唐泽圣等著清华大学出版社
4. 计算机图形学(Computer Graphics).Donald Hearn等著电子工业出版社
5. Fundamentals of Computer Graphics, Peter Shirley, second edition, AKPeters
计算机图形学的每日课堂练习和作业提交包括:
1. 第一章计算机图形学综述
2. 第二章图形系统的框架
3. 第三章图形学基本问题
4. 第四章基本图形(二维)和几何实体(三维)生成技术
5. 第五章计算机图形学的应用
计算机图形学的发展前景非常广阔,随着技术的不断发展和改进,计算机图形学将继续扮演着越来越重要的角色在计算机科学和技术领域。
129 浏览量
2013-09-22 上传
点击了解资源详情
点击了解资源详情
2022-06-01 上传
2022-10-27 上传
2010-05-12 上传
2021-09-28 上传
杜浩明
- 粉丝: 15
- 资源: 2万+
最新资源
- Angular程序高效加载与展示海量Excel数据技巧
- Argos客户端开发流程及Vue配置指南
- 基于源码的PHP Webshell审查工具介绍
- Mina任务部署Rpush教程与实践指南
- 密歇根大学主题新标签页壁纸与多功能扩展
- Golang编程入门:基础代码学习教程
- Aplysia吸引子分析MATLAB代码套件解读
- 程序性竞争问题解决实践指南
- lyra: Rust语言实现的特征提取POC功能
- Chrome扩展:NBA全明星新标签壁纸
- 探索通用Lisp用户空间文件系统clufs_0.7
- dheap: Haxe实现的高效D-ary堆算法
- 利用BladeRF实现简易VNA频率响应分析工具
- 深度解析Amazon SQS在C#中的应用实践
- 正义联盟计划管理系统:udemy-heroes-demo-09
- JavaScript语法jsonpointer替代实现介绍